When is Black Friday 2026?
Black Friday 2026 falls on November 27, 2026. But deals start much earlier — many retailers begin their Black Friday sales in early November, with the biggest discounts dropping on Thanksgiving Day and Black Friday itself.

How to Prepare for Black Friday
1. Make a List
Know what you want to buy. Research prices now so you can spot real deals.

3. Set Price Alerts
Track products on price comparison sites. When the price drops on Black Friday, you'll know immediately.
4. Check Multiple Stores
The same product may be cheaper at a different retailer. Compare before buying.
Black Friday vs Cyber Monday
Black Friday is better for: in-store deals, big-ticket electronics, appliances
Cyber Monday is better for: online-only deals, software, smaller electronics, fashion
